São Tomé and Príncipe is an island country in west-central Africa, consisting of the islands of São Tomé and Príncipe and the surrounding islets, with the capital, São Tomé, located in the northeastern part of São Tomé. Located on the Gulf of Guinea, about 200 kilometers from the African continent, the country was colonized by Portugal in the 15th century and became independent in 1975, with Portuguese as the official language and an economy based on agriculture (cocoa, palm oil) and tourism. Yadong is located in the Tibet Autonomous Region of China in the south of the city of Shigatse, located in the southern foothills of the Himalayas, is an important border county connecting China and South Asia, known as the "Tibet small Jiangnan" reputation. The average altitude of 2800 meters, the climate is warm and humid, the forest coverage rate of more than 30%, with Yadonggou, Duoqing Lake, Kangbu hot springs and other natural landscapes, snow-capped mountains, lakes, meadows intertwined with a wealth of ecological resources. Historically, Yadong was the key station of the "Tea and Horse Road" to South Asia, and the border trade was prosperous; nowadays, Yadong Port is still preserved, and it is an important foreign trade channel in Tibet. There are many ethnic groups such as Tibetans and Han Chinese living here, and the unique border culture and Tibetan style are blended with the magnificent beauty of the Snowy Plateau and the spiritual beauty of the Jiangnan water town colliding here, making it a tourist destination with both natural and humanistic charms.
